ABA 640 An Analysis of Verbal Behavior 3.0 Credits

This course will introduce students to Skinner’s (1957) analysis of verbal behavior, including the use and classification of verbal operants, private events, and language training. Students will learn strategies to assess language deficits and instructional tools to teach vocal and non-vocal verbal responses. Lastly, students will read seminal and current research related to verbal behavior and understand its application to teaching individuals with language delays.
